BD62 ZBZ is a 2012 Fiat Qubo in Red with a 1,248c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 13 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 76.9%.

Across all 2012 Fiat Qubo models, the average MOT pass rate is 76.0% with a typical mileage of 47,526 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.

The most common reason a Fiat Qubo fails its MOT is coil spring broken, accounting for 1,304 recorded failures. If you're considering buying BD62 ZBZ,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Fiat Qubo typically stays on UK roads for around 18 years. At 14 years old, this Fiat Qubo is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
